• Detroit police chief asked activist to remove photos of Mayor Mary Sheffield with ex (cbsnews.com) — Detroit's police chief is under scrutiny after a local activist says the chief personally asked him to remove social media photos of Mayor Mary Sheffield with an ex-boyfriend, shortly before police detained the activist and seized his phone. The chief insists the criminal investigation into alleged threats began earlier and is unrelated, while Sheffield denies misusing city resources or funds and says she remains focused on serving Detroit residents.

• Garden Bowl on Woodward celebrates 80 years of business (fox2detroit.com) — Midtown Detroit's historic Garden Bowl on Woodward is marking 80 years of Zainea family ownership while continuing to serve as a go-to spot for bowling, pizza, and live music. The alley, considered the nation's oldest continuously operating commercial bowling alley, is celebrating by supporting 80 local charities this year, including offering free bowling to some groups.

• This lawyer is stepping up as legal star Fieger continues stroke rehab (detroitnews.com) — A longtime protégé of famed trial lawyer Geoffrey Fieger is now leading the Metro Detroit-based Fieger Law firm while Fieger continues stroke rehabilitation, keeping the high-profile practice active in local and national cases. The new CEO, James Harrington, says the Southfield firm is growing, adding staff and continuing major civil-rights and wrongful-death work, including cases involving Detroit police.
